The Problem

Manually erasing or redrawing lines is slow and messy. It's easy to make mistakes, lose track of which parts to keep, and waste time fixing errors. This slows down your whole design process.

The Solution

Sketch trim and extend tools let you quickly cut off extra parts of lines or extend them to meet other lines automatically. This makes cleaning up your sketches fast, precise, and error-free.
